Scotland has 1,422 SSSIs, covering around 1,011,000 hectares or 12.6% of Scotland’s land area (above mean low water springs). Sites range in size from the very small, like Bo’mains Meadow SSSI, at just under a hectare, to the vast Cairngorms SSSI, which extends to more than 29,000 hectares.
